Iran plans to add 5 million tons to petchem output

Business Materials 17 October 2016 12:41 (UTC +04:00)

Baku, Azerbaijan, Oct. 17

By Emil Ilgar – Trend:

Iran plans to add 5 million tons per year to its petrochemical production capacity by the end of the current fiscal year (March 20, 2017), the country's oil minister Bijan Namdar Zanganeh said Oct.17.

Currently Iran’s nominal petrochemical production capacity stands at above 60 million tons per day, but the actual capacity is less than 55 million tons.

Zanganeh added that during next four years, some $52 billion worth of investment would be attracted in petrochemical sector.

He didn’t mention the output capacity, but Iran plans to double its petchem production capacity by 2021.
